January Challenge by Tracy


Posted by PicasaNew Design Team Member Tracy submitted this calendar for the January NEW Challenge. She said, "this project was inspired by the something NEW challenge at Scrap Our Stash. This frame was found at a local thrift store for $2.50 and when I saw it I thought it would be great for a scrapbook page display. But after our family scrapbook calendar kept falling off the wall, I decided that we needed something more sturdy and nicer looking.



The frame was white and since our walls are white I decided that I could pull some of the colors from my favorite kitchen decoration (which is a metal rooster) and use them on this project. I really like the end result. And although we don't have a monthly scrapbook page we still have some of our favorite photos from 2010 displayed. I first sanded and then primed the frame, and then I painted it black (using acrylic paints from my stash) once dry I painted it red (the red was mixed with black to make it a darker red) and then I wiped off some of the red paint with a damp cloth, I repeated that step a couple of times allowing the paint to dry for a few minutes in between each coat. The end result is a red distressed with black looking frame.

This month's challenge has really got me thinking about all the new things that I want to try with home decor as well as scrapbooking. Smiles, Tracy"

January Challege by Amie



Posted by PicasaReader Amie submitted this calendar for the January New Challenge.  She said, "I'm snowed in at home and the kids are watching a movie! Scrapbook time YEAH!!!!! So I'm starting my calendar and thought this would be a fun way to remember all those family Birthday's and Anniversaries through the year.



I used leftover "caboodle" CTMH papers cut to 3 inch by 4 inch and Colonial white for the months and Birthday/Aniv. strips.


The embellishments are sparkles and cute owl from Stampin UP (My friend Keri sold me the punch and I LOVE it)


Slip the 12x12 in a page protector and Ta Dah you have a reminder all year round (or an organized way to make special cards for those that are closest and most dear to you)
